First & for most what we see is not the actual bumper, its a piece of plastic that goes over the ugly metal bumper underneath. I know that there is a difference in our body styles (I have a 97) but I think that it is all pretty much the same set up, so here goes:
First there are going to be a couple of brackets on the sides. If you are planning on taking off the bumper & not putting it back on then only unbolt it from the body (mine only took 2 bolts per bracket), if you are simply wanting to close the gap, make sure that all the bolts are in place & tightened down. Next there are little "clips" that help the bumper hook into the Pathfinder, I want to say I had 8 in total, go through & pop them out or if you are planning on closing the gap, simply make sure that they are all in place (everyonce in a while they will break, being that they are made of plastic). Now that takes care of the plastic bumper cover. It should look like this:You see the big ugly black metal thing? That is the real bumper.
If you are reading this next part I am going to assume (I don't like to "assume" because it makes an A$$ out of U & ME, get it?) that you are taking the bumper off, so under the bumper you should see two braces of such that have 4 bolts each that conect the actual bumper. Now all you have to do is unbolt or break them, as was the case with 2 of mine, in which it should look something like this:
